    My wife and myself have 88 acre fully off-grid permaculture farm in Sorrento, BC, Canada. Purchased property in 2013 and now have gone fully off grid and developed small scale production of poultry meat, eggs, lamb, beef, and "food forest" which includes a variety of fruit trees, raspberry, strawberries, asparagus, and vegetable gardens. We have also started planting for an apple cidery with our first 400 apple trees started in a nursery. We are in our third year of food production and want to continue expanding the farm activities with a goal of being sustainable for food and cashflow within the next 5 years. We seek a young couple or person(s) experienced in successful sustainable organic or permaculture market gardening, greenhouse food production, to join us. We are planning to build and install year round geo air greenhouse(s) as well as pasture based layer mobile coops and rotating pasture management with layers, meat chickens, cattle and sheep, as well as expanding our pasture meat bird production and local food marketing including website and social marketing and developing a CSA program.     See above, we are one of the very few off grid permaculture farms in Canada. We focus on reducing the carbon footprint of operating a farm and improving the sustainability using regenerative permaculture farming techniques. We produce our own water, power, heat, and cycle nutrients within the farm reducing any farm inputs as much as possible and continuing to improve our farming processes and quality outputs.

    In the Spring we will be starting plants in the greenhouse and building up the manure piles for composting and getting the soils ready for planting. We have a mobile chicken coop to build for 200 layers, and two new mobile chicken tractors to add to the four we already have in operation. We have a small barn renovation project underway. We have 35 varieties of heritage apple nursery trees to transplant into an orchard setting. In summer months we have some forest management to undertake including moving dead logs out of the forest for processing and then splitting and stacking wood in the wood shed for winter. We also have hay making activities starting in late June all the way to late August processing and storing up to 4,000 bales of hay for the winter time. Year round care needed for flock of sheep, small number of cattle, two horses, turkeys, meat chickens and layers. We can use some help in preparing for the three farmers markets we attend including processing eggs, asparagus, strawberries, raspberries, tree fruit and meat products for sale.
